Shining in his final game in an SJSU uniform despite wet and windy conditions, senior quarterback Josh Love threw for 290 yards and ran for a touchdown to lead his team to the one-point win. Wide receiver Tre Walker brought in eight receptions for 132 yards on the night, while running back Dejon Packer added 93 yards and the game-winning touchdown with just over two minutes remaining. - c/o sjsuspartans.com

I remember how much fun it was in the PCAA/Big West from about 1981 until FSU left for the WAC.  Those were crazy days and they were a blast.  The two teams pretty nearly split their games over that timeframe, and the winner of that game almost always won the conference.  I doubt those days can be repeated, but it would be so much fun if this game meant a lot more again.
